Why Time Delay Fuses Are Essential for Heavy Machinery

In the realm of heavy machinery, where equipment operates under demanding conditions, the importance of reliable protection systems cannot be overstated. One crucial component that ensures the safety and longevity of electrical systems is the time delay fuse. These fuses are not only designed to safeguard against faults but also to enhance operational efficiency by providing critical protection during startup surges and transient faults. Here’s why time delay fuses are essential for heavy machinery:

  1. Handling Inrush Currents

Heavy machinery, such as industrial motors and large compressors, often experiences a surge in current when they are powered on. This inrush current can be significantly higher than the normal operating current, sometimes several times more. A standard fuse may blow immediately in response to this surge, which can interrupt the operation. Time delay fuses, however, are specifically designed to tolerate these temporary surges without tripping. This delay ensures that the machinery can start up without unnecessary interruptions, reducing downtime and improving overall productivity.

  1. Protecting Against Short-Term Overloads

During normal operation, heavy machinery can sometimes experience short-term overloads due to varying operational loads or temporary mechanical issues. A time delay fuse allows for a brief period where the fuse can withstand these overloads without blowing, giving the system time to stabilize. This feature is particularly important in environments where load conditions may fluctuate, helping to prevent unnecessary maintenance or downtime caused by false fuse activations.

  1. Reducing Unnecessary Downtime

Downtime in industrial settings can be costly. Time delay fuses minimize the risk of unexpected failures by providing protection against both sustained faults and short, non-damaging overloads. By delaying the response to brief overloads or inrush currents, these fuses ensure that machinery continues to operate smoothly without frequent interruptions, which could otherwise lead to delays in production and service.

  1. Enhancing Equipment Longevity

The longer a machine operates without interruptions, the longer its components will last. Time delay fuses prevent frequent fuse blowouts caused by momentary electrical surges, ensuring that the machinery isn’t subjected to unnecessary stress. This contributes to the overall longevity of both the machinery and its electrical components, making time delay fuses an investment in reducing long-term operational costs.

  1. Simplifying Maintenance

When a fuse blows, it often signals a fault in the system that requires investigation. Time delay fuses reduce the number of false trips, which in turn reduces the frequency of maintenance checks. This leads to a more streamlined maintenance process, as operators can focus on addressing actual issues rather than dealing with minor surges or short-term overloads.
